| Query: Birds & nature magazine | Result: 20558th of 32657 | |
Lettered Aracari - Pteroglossus inscriptus
Resolution: 700x499
File Size: 68492 Bytes
Upload Date: 2008:07:16 16:43:06
|
|
|
|
Birds & nature magazine 20558/32657 |
|
|
^o^
Animal Pictures Archive for smart phones
^o^
|
|